Plenty of Rangers fans were highly critical of centre-back Connor Goldson for his performance in midweek as Steven Gerrard’s side conceded ground in the Premiership title race.
Rangers looked in firm control of the game against Aberdeen after half an hour on Wednesday night, having raced into a 2-0 lead with goals from Scott Arfield and Ryan Jack. [via BBC]
However, the home side restored parity by the 48th minute at Pittodrie, with Jon Gallagher and Andrew Considine on target, and the ‘Gers ended up dropping two points, the margin by which they now trail league leaders Celtic after their last-gasp win over Hamilton.
Goldson, who played the full 90 minutes to maintain his ever-present status in the Premiership after 15 games of the season, was booked in the closing stages and came in for unforgiving reviews from reporters as well as Rangers fans.
James Black of Rangers News said that the 26-year-old was “posted missing as Gallagher grabbed a goal back for Aberdeen and not much better at the second”, while Ayush Chaurasia of The 4th Official gave him a lowly rating of three, writing that he “was all over the place defensively for both the goals” scored by the Dons.
